Angeles to skip Palaro

Bacoleņo Charles Ellis Angeles who plays for the Iloilo Commercial Central High School in Iloilo will miss the Palarong Pambansa calendared for April 22-28 in Koronadal, South Cotabato as he is set to train at the La Salle-Greenhills this summer, or might leave for the Unites States for a caging camp in Houston, Texas.

Angeles, an athletic scholar at the Iloilo Commercial Central High School, was recruited by La Salle-Greenhills, and had been lured by 12 prestigious teams from Manila, Cebu and Bacolod.

Standing 5-foot-11, the 12-year-old Angeles steered Iloilo to a title-clinching 74-67 triumph over Negros during the Western Visayas Regional Athletic Association Meet held in February in Bacolod City. His father Ely Angeles is a former regional official of the Games and Amusements Board.

Honed by coach Bong Conlu of Iloilo Commercial Central High School, his father said they are thankful for the help extended by Dexter Dy, team manager Kim Santos, and neighbor Toto Maderazo who first taught his son the basics of basketball.*
